exercise-induced bronchoconstriction
more termed exercise-induced asthma, preferred , more accurate term exercise-induced bronchoconstriction better reflects underlying pathophysiology. preferred due former term giving false impression asthma caused exercise.
in patient eib, exercise follows normal patterns of bronchodilation. however, 3 minutes, constriction sets in, peaks @ around 10–15 minutes, , resolves hour. during episode of type of bronchoconstriction, levels of inflammatory mediators, particularly leukotrienes, histamine, , interleukin, increase. th2-type lymphocytes activated, increase in t cells expressing cd25 (il-2r), , b cells expressing cd 23, causing increased production of ige. after exercise, conditions fade within 1 3 minutes. in sufferers of eib, followed refractory period, of less 4 hours, during if exercise repeated, bronchoconstriction less emphasised. caused release of prostaglandins.
the underlying cause of type of bronchoconstriction appear large volume of cool, dry air inhaled during strenuous exercise. condition appears improve when air inhaled more humidified , closer body temperature.
this specific condition, in general population, can vary between 7 , 20 percent. increases around 80 percent in symptomatic asthma. in many cases, however, constriction, during or after strenuous exercise, not clinically significant except in cases of severe moderate emphysema.
in may 2013, american thoracic society issued first treatment guidelines eib.
allergen-induced bronchoconstriction
while different cause, has similar symptoms, namely immunological reaction involving release of inflammatory mediators.
inhalation of allergens in sensitized subjects develops bronchoconstriction within 10 minutes, reaches maximum within 30 minutes, , resolves within 1 3 hours. in subjects, constriction not return normal, , recurs after 3 4 hours, may last day or more. first named asthmatic response, , latter late asthmatic response.
bronchioconstriction can occur result of anaphylaxis, when allergen not inhaled.
